Understanding Surface Restoration Services


Surface restoration services involve preparing and renewing surfaces to bring them back to their original or improved condition. This process often includes cleaning, repairing, and refinishing surfaces such as walls, decks, fences, and floors. The goal is to remove imperfections, old paint, rust, or dirt and create a smooth, clean base for new paint or coatings.


One of the most effective methods for surface preparation is sandblasting. This technique uses high-pressure abrasive materials to strip away unwanted layers, revealing a fresh surface underneath. It is especially useful for removing rust from metal, peeling paint from wood, or stubborn stains on concrete.


After sandblasting, professional painting services apply high-quality paints and finishes that protect and beautify your home. Whether it’s a vibrant new color for your exterior walls or a durable epoxy coating for your garage floor, surface restoration services ensure long-lasting results.

Can I Paint After Sandblasting?


A common question homeowners ask is whether painting can be done immediately after sandblasting. The answer is yes, but with some important considerations to ensure the best results.


Why Paint After Sandblasting?


Sandblasting removes old paint, rust, and debris, leaving a clean and roughened surface. This texture helps new paint adhere better, resulting in a longer-lasting finish. However, the surface must be properly prepared before painting.


Key Steps Before Painting


  1. Surface Inspection: Check for any damage or areas that need repair after sandblasting.

  2. Cleaning: Remove any dust or residue left from the sandblasting process.

  3. Drying: Ensure the surface is completely dry to prevent moisture-related paint issues.

  4. Priming: Apply a suitable primer to seal the surface and improve paint adhesion.

  5. Painting: Use high-quality paint designed for the specific surface and environment.


Timing Matters


Painting should ideally be done soon after sandblasting to prevent rust or dirt from accumulating again. However, if there is a delay, the surface must be protected or re-cleaned before painting.


By following these steps, you can achieve a smooth, durable, and attractive finish that revitalizes your home’s surfaces.


How Sandblasting and Painting Can Transform Your Home


The combination of sandblasting and painting is a powerful way to restore and beautify your home. Here are some examples of how these services can make a difference:


Exterior Walls and Siding


Over time, exterior walls can develop peeling paint, mildew, and dirt buildup. Sandblasting removes these layers, exposing a clean surface ready for a fresh coat of paint. This not only improves the look but also protects the siding from weather damage.


Decks and Fences


Wooden decks and fences are exposed to sun, rain, and insects. Sandblasting removes old paint, stains, and rough patches, making the wood smooth and ready for sealing or painting. This extends the life of your outdoor structures and enhances your yard’s appearance.


Concrete and Masonry


Driveways, patios, and walkways can become stained or cracked. Sandblasting cleans and smooths these surfaces, allowing for the application of protective coatings or paint that resist wear and weather.


Interior Walls and Floors


In some cases, sandblasting is used indoors to remove old paint or finishes from walls and floors. This prepares the surface for repainting or applying epoxy coatings, creating a fresh and modern look.

Tips for Maintaining Your Painted Surfaces


After investing in professional surface restoration, proper maintenance will keep your home looking great longer. Here are some practical tips:


  • Regular Cleaning: Wash exterior walls and decks with mild soap and water to remove dirt and prevent mold.

  • Inspect Annually: Check for peeling paint, cracks, or damage and address issues promptly.

  • Touch-Up Paint: Keep some leftover paint for small repairs to maintain a uniform look.

  • Protect from Moisture: Ensure gutters and drainage systems direct water away from painted surfaces.

  • Seasonal Care: In Jacksonville’s humid climate, consider applying sealants or protective coatings yearly.


Following these simple steps helps preserve the beauty and integrity of your home’s surfaces.
